Just so you guys know
In most SAT reports for major recruits, they still do not count the ‘writing’ portion of the SAT.
Most major schools actually continue to omit that number from their ‘average SAT’ number, for both athletes and non-athletes. USC is one of the few schools I’m aware of that actually includes the ‘composite score’ (Math/Verbal/Writing) as part of their averages.
So, I’m sure the reported number is for the two traditional sections (Math/Verbal).
